Each member may create ONE thread in the New Member Check-in Folder (that is this folder right here. Not this thread. You MUST create your own thread). Your post must be titled using the following format:
Your Full Name (or pen name): Short description
For example: my thread would be called “Christina McMullen: Scifi and Fantasy Author” but if I have a new release, I might change it to “Christina McMullen: Preorder is Live for (NEW TITLE)”
In your initial post (repeating from above: do not comment below, please make a new topic), please introduce yourself. You may also link to your books, blog, or whatever. This is your thread to talk about you. Mods will monitor this folder and once we've welcomed you, we'll sort you into the correct folder.
Please do not post first in the alphabetized folders. We will delete you if you do.
You do not need to be an author to have a showcase thread. All we ask is that each member follow our rules. The rules are very simple:
Threads without a proper title will be deleted.
More than one member thread will be deleted.
Do not “bump” your post. If you have something to say, say it, but artificially bumping to be first will result in other posts being pinned to the top so that yours will never get there.
DO NOTE: It is up to you as to whether or not you want to invite others to post on your thread or if you want this to be just a showcase for you. As these will not be monitored as closely, please let a moderator know if you are having trouble with harassment or hijackers on your thread. Obviously, do not harass or hijack fellow members’ threads.
